On Saturday, 13th September 2025, East Riding Archives brought our ‘Archiverse Minecraft’ activity to East Riding Leisure Bridlington as part of the Heritage Open Days festival.
This year’s theme, Architecture, inspired us to delve into our collections for Bridlington-related building plans and photographs. These served as creative prompts for participants to recreate historic structures within our growing Archiverse world in the Minecraft videogame.

The East Riding Archiverse is a fun, educational world created in the ‘Minecraft: Education Edition’ videogame where young people can explore a virtual reconstruction of the East Riding Archives and share their lived experiences with others. Each built and written story crafted in the ‘Archiverse’ is added to the real-world archives as a historical record, making each young person a history maker!
